Our Pastor: Floyd T. Davidson, and his wife Marsha.



Pastor and Marsha both were born in Canton, Ohio, They were high-school sweethearts and married on November 23, 1968, six months after Marsha’s graduation. God blessed this union with two children and five grandchildren.

Marsha was saved as a teen during a revival service at the Canton Baptist Temple. Pastor was saved at home at the age of twenty, due largely to the soul-winning efforts of one of the pastoral staff members of the same church. Shortly thereafter, while attending a family camp, the lord called him into full-time ministry. At the time, he was working in the computer center of the Timken Roller Bearing Company and Marsha was employed as a dental assistant. He and Marsha together committed their lives to serve the Lord Jesus Christ.

Upon graduation from Baptist Bible College in Springfield, Missouri they entered full-time ministry. During the past quarter of a century they have been faithfully serving the Lord. Bro. Davidson has served as youth pastor, bus minister, Sunday School coordinator, and Pastor. Before coming to Liberty Baptist Church they also served as church planting missionaries. From 1985 until 1997 they were Baptist Bible Fellowship missionaries to the country of Belize, Central America. This experience broadened their vision beyond the limits of the local church to realize that God wants to use every Christian to help fulfill the great commission of getting the Gospel to "all the world."

Marsha’s talents of encouragement, organization, and motivation have been greatly used by God to bring people to the Savior as well as motivate them to serve. Through such ministries as Sunday School, choir, ladies meetings, teen mentoring, etc. she has shown her God-given abilities to reach people with the Gospel and train them in the things of God.

Years ago in that family camp they surrendered their lives to "go where He wanted them to go . . . anytime . . . anyplace!" Their years of faithful service along with the diversity of ministry and localities have served as evidence of the sincerity of their commitment to each other and their Lord.
